Summary:
The Aspire Rosa Parks Academy District in Stockton, California, contains a single elementary school, Aspire Rosa Parks Academy, serving grades K-5 with 403 students.
This school faces significant academic challenges, consistently ranking in the bottom 5-7% of all California elementary schools over the past three years. Student proficiency in English, math, and science is substantially below state averages, though there is a positive trend of improvement as students progress from 3rd to 5th grade. A major concern is the chronic absenteeism rate of 29.9%, which is more than 10 points higher than the state average and is a known barrier to academic success.
With over 80% of students qualifying for free or reduced-price lunch, the school community reflects significant economic need. The school operates with a 20-to-1 student-teacher ratio and spends approximately $18,951 per student, which is above the state average, indicating resources are available to support improvement efforts focused on attendance and targeted academic interventions.
